The choice concerning the physical properties of metals is not considered one of the main areas that biochemists study. Biochemistry primarily focuses on the chemical processes and substances that occur within living organisms. This includes examining how the structure of biomolecules such as proteins, lipids, carbohydrates, and nucleic acids relates to their function, exploring metabolic pathways and the chemical reactions that sustain life, and understanding how organisms communicate through signaling molecules and biochemical pathways.

In contrast, while physical properties of metals may be relevant in other scientific disciplines, such as inorganic chemistry or materials science, they do not directly relate to the core concerns of biochemistry. Biochemists concentrate on the molecular and cellular underpinnings of biological processes rather than on the attributes of metals themselves. Therefore, this option stands out as distinct from the primary focus of the field.
